Originally Posted by paxton
Getting a base Carrera 2 with a MSRP around 103K. Would love to hear your suggestions and different numbers. Thanks!


Are you buying an inventory car (i.e. 2017)? Or are you ordering a 2018 car.


Depends what kind of discounts are you getting. Discount, credit, where you live, and how many miles you need will be the key deciding factors for what plans to go with. Feel free to PM me this instead since is more personal to you.


Current residual is 66% for Carrera 2 base for 10,000 miles per year on 30 months. Money factor for Tier 1 (FICO 740+) is 0.0022. Whether you should do 24 months, 36 months, 39 months, 42months instead depending on if you need 5k miles per year, 7.5k, 12k, 15k, or even more miles per year.
